      Here is a list of these helping verbs, divided into present tense and past tense. PRESENT TENSE. PAST TENSE. am was. is was. are were. do did. does did. has had. have had. The verbs listed above can be either main verbs or helping verbs. They are main verbs when they are single-word verbs. However, none of the verbs in the list are participles ...

      The simple present tense employs the s-form or base-form of the verb. The simple present is used for repeated actions, facts or generalizations, or non-continuous verbs expressing now. The passive voice applies “is,are,or am + past participle.”
